<p>I found this place right down on the peer in Long Beach when looking online because Kelly and I were going down to see the Star Trek Tour at the Queen Mary. It is a large restaurant right at the end of the boardwalk (which seems a plastic fantastic version of Oaks Bluffs on Marthas Vineyard). It is quite large and has indoor and outdoor seating as well as a sushi bar. The service is good, and the food was quite tasty. I would certainly try this place again if I was in Long Beach.</p>

<p>Both Kelly and I had the California Style Clam Chowder, which is New England Style Clam Chowder with California Clams, which were tasty and not gummy at all. The Chowder was thick and quite tasty. And I liked the cracker that they put in their as well, tasted like a normal cracker, but sure didn&#8217;t look like it. I had a bowl and Kelly had a cup.</p>

<p>I know I am supposed to be dieting, but I went for the FIsh and Chips, which were quite tasty, though the batter was a bit too thick for my taste. It had 2 pieces of fish and french fries, and I used my regular malt vinegar to bring it to taste. The fish was quite good though.</p>

<p>Kelly had the crab cakes for an entree, and they were excellent, as was the tasty sauce they put on them, which was a chipotle aioli and it also includes some tasty field greens.</p>

<p>This place was quite good, and has a great view of the Queen Mary, the harbor and the lighthouse across the way, and the outside tables are surrounded by plexiglass to keep the wind off, which is quite nice as you are right on the harbor. This place is pretty damn good.</p>

Listed as a top 5 buffets by the Food Network, this place is pretty decent, but the food is of course buffet quality, but pretty damn decent for $11.95 lunch and $20.95 per person dinner. It is located one block away from the promenade, and remember not to fill up on too many drinks, which they will refill quickly to try to fill you up. A decent meal that will fill you, but of course nothing amazing.

The best thing is the sushi with salmon, yellowtail, red snapper, scallops, squid, salmon roe, sea urchin, cooked shrimp, octopus, fresh water eel and vegetarian sushi. They also have various cooked seafood, as well as chicken terriyaki and other asian dishes, and some delicious fresh fruit,
</p>
<p>
The service is fast (you serve yourself, and they try to fill you on drinks) and the food is decent, so it is worth it if you are hungry.</p>
